B Meson Decay Constants Using Relativistic Heavy Quarks

Abstract

We present an update on ongoing work to extract pseudoscalar and vector decay constants for B()B^{(*)}, Bs()B^{(*)}_s and Bc()B^{(*)}_c mesons and determine phenomenologically-interesting ratios such as fBs/fBf_{B_s}/f_B or fB/fBf_{B^*}/f_B. Our calculation is based on Nf=2+1{\rm N_f}=2+1 dynamical flavour gauge field ensembles generated by the RBC/UKQCD collaborations using domain-wall fermions and the Iwasaki gauge action. Using domain-wall light, strange, and charm quarks and relativistic bb quarks, we obtain results at multiple lattice spacings and valence quark masses.
